Predicted to enable identical protein binding activity. Acts upstream of or within several processes, including animal organ development; cardiac muscle contraction; and negative regulation of transcription by RNA polymerase II. Predicted to be located in cell junction; cytosol; and intercellular bridge. Is expressed in alimentary system; sensory organ; and vibrissa. Used to study arrhythmogenic right ventricular cardiomyopathy. Orthologous to human PPP1R13L (protein phosphatase 1 regulatory subunit 13 like).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
